Responsibilities

  • Solution Design & Technical Leadership
  • Lead architecture and design of complex data pipelines on Databricks lakehouse architecture (Unity Catalog, Delta Lake, Structured Streaming)
  • Design and build data foundations that enable AI/ML capabilities - feature stores, embedding pipelines, vector search indexes, and model training datasets
  • Align data engineering solutions with business strategy, including support for Agentic AI workloads
  • Optimize pipeline performance (Delta Lake table layouts, clustering, Z-ordering) and establish monitoring/alerting best practices with clear SLAs
  • Build data infrastructure supporting Agentic AI systems - real-time data access layers, context retrieval pipelines, and agent-accessible data services
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with DevOps, Platform Engineering, and MLOps roles to integrate data solutions into the broader technology environment and shared AI infratstructure - Mlflow registries, feature stores, and agent orchestration layers
  • Provide consultation to Senior Leadership on complex projects and drive continuous improvement initiatives
  • Implement data quality strategies (master data management, validation rules, Delta Live Tables expectations) to ensure trust in enterprise data

Requirements

  • 5+ years with Python and SQL in data engineering for big data ML/analytics workloads
  • 3+ years with cloud data services (AWS), container orchestration (Docker, Kubernetes), and IaC (Terraform, CloudFormation)
  • 3+ years architecting ML workflows and data platforms with CI/CD, automated testing, and distributed processing (Spark)
  • 3+ years collaborating cross-functionally with Data Science, MLOps, Platform Engineering, and DevOps teams
  • 3+ years implementing data quality testing and optimizing SQL/Python for cost/performance in the cloud
  • 2+ years hands-on with Databricks (Delta Lake, Unity Catalog, Databricks SQL)
  • Experience with MLflow experiment tracking and model registry workflows
  • Experience designing pipelines that serve AI/ML inference - real-time feature engineering, embedding generation, and context retrieval for LLM-based systems
  • Familiarity with Databricks Mosaic AI, Vector Search, and/or Feature Store
